Desjardins, sponsor of the Génies en herbe : l'aventure game show

 

Do you remember the popular game show Génies en herbe? Well, you'll be happy to know that it's making a comeback on Radio-Canada. Be sure to watch the new Génies en herbe : l'aventure game show, starting in January.

The general knowledge of secondary 5 and grade 11 students will be put to the test every Saturday at 4:00 p.m., from January 8 to April 16, 2011, through an exciting adventure.

Desjardins, proud sponsor

Having education and young people at heart, Desjardins is proud to sponsor this program where contestants work together to take up a series of challenges.

The Boni Desjardins question

During the first 8 programs, 2 bursaries will be awarded as part of the Boni Desjardins question. A student delegated by his school will appear on the show to ask a question relating to financial education. The Génies en herbe contestant who answers it correctly, as well as the student, will each receive $500 to put towards a group project at their school.

Boni Desjardins questions

Show of January 8, 2011
Question: How much do you need to save each month for 8 months to buy a $560 bike?

Answer: $70

Winners
  • Céline Rivard, 10th grader at Centre scolaire Léo-Rémillard High School in Winnipeg, asked the question.

    The "Littératie : coup de coeur" project encourages Centre scolaire Léo-Rémillard High School students to read in French. School personnel and students are invited to place a "Coup de cœur" bookmark in the library books they've liked to motivate others to read them. The Desjardins bursary will help the library buy new books and periodicals.

  • Joël Ayotte, 11th grader at Centre scolaire Léo-Rémillard High School in Winnipeg, correctly answered the question.

    Since Joël is also a student at Centre scolaire Léo-Rémillard High School, the school will receive $1,000 instead of $500 for the "Littératie : coup de coeur" project.

Congratulations!
